I'm currently building a kart from scratch out of a shopping kart and an old frame. The engine I'm using is a kohler 25hp v-twin and I'm going to be hooking up a turbo for a 2.0 liter Kia to it. I expect it to make around 10 psi of boost. I need to find a clutch capable of what I'm predicting to be around 30 horsepower, that's under the 200 dollar mark. Any advice?

I'm to the point of wondering if the pto clutch would work. its something I'm a lot more familiar with, I know how to wire them, how to properly mount and set them up, and that would mean the shaft diameter would be perfect for the engine. The only problem is with it instantly engaging, I might smoke a few belts.

I'm going to wait until you post what your end game is with this project until I sacrifice a perfectly sharpened crayon on this one.
Details like - will this be used on or off road? Target top speed? Suspension? Tire size? Live axle or a diff? Total weight of kart and rider(s)?
All of this info and more is important to make informed choices on parts selection.
